摘 要:齿轮钢是用于加工制造齿轮的钢材,齿轮钢中的夹杂物级别是影响齿轮寿命的关键因素。以20CrMnTiH齿轮钢为研究对象,形成囊括铁水预处理、转炉冶炼、LF精炼、真空脱气(VD)、方坯连铸等工艺流程的控制体系。一是将转炉终点温度从1 660℃调整至1 620℃,将终点碳含量从0.03%调整至0.08%,使得钢中氧含量从0.092%降低至0.034%;二是优化精炼渣系,将氧化钙含量由62%~66%调整至55%~60%,将三氧化二铝含量由25%~31%调整至32%~36%,将二氧化硅含量由6%~10%调整至4%~9%;三是在真空脱气工序中,将真空时间由12 min延长至18 min,促进氢、氧等元素的去除;四是在方坯连铸过程中,采取保护浇铸措施,避免钢水与空气接触,避免因二次氧化而产生夹杂物。试制结果表明:A类细系夹杂物由2.0级降低至1.0级、粗系夹杂物由1.0级降低至0.5级;D类细系夹杂物由1.5级降低至1.0级、粗系夹杂物由1.0级降低至0.5级。成品能够满足高质量品种要求。Gear steel is a kind of steel used to manufacture gears,and the inclusion level in the gear steel is a key factor affecting the life of gear.Taking 20CrMnTiH gear steel as the research object,a control hierarchy including hot metal pretreatment,converter smelting,LF refining,vacuum degassing (VD) and billet continuous casting was formed.Firstly,the end temperature of converter was adjusted from 1 660℃ to 1 620℃,and the end carbon content was adjusted from 0.03% to 0.08%,so that the oxygen content in the steel was reduced from 0.092% to 0.034%.Secondly,optimized was the refined slag system,adjusted were the content of calcium oxide (from 62%~66% to 55%~60%),aluminum oxide (from 25%~31% to 32%~36%) and silicon dioxide (from 6%~10% to 4%~9%).Thirdly,in the vacuum degassing process,the vacuum time was extended from 12 min to 18 min,which promoted the removal of elements such as hydrogen and oxygen.Fourthly,in the process of billet continuous casting,protective casting measures were taken to avoid the contact between molten steel and air,and avoid the inclusion caused by secondary oxidation.The trial-production results show:Class A fine inclusions are reduced from Grade 2.0 to Grade 1.0,and coarse inclusions are reduced from Grade 1.0 to Grade 0.5;Class D fine-grained inclusions are reduced from Grade 1.5 to Grade 1.0,and coarse-grained inclusions are reduced from Grade 1.0 to Grade 0.5.The finished products can meet the requirements of high-quality varieties.
